Working together for animal health: German and Polish research institutes intensify cooperation

Press Releases

Pulawy/Greifswald - Riems Island, 26. March 2024: The Friedrich-Loeffler-Institut (FLI) and the National Veterinary Research Institute (PIWet) in Pulawy, Poland, today signed a groundbreaking agreement to intensify their cooperation. The focus will be on the diagnosis of animal diseases. PiWet is particularly interested in collaborating in the areas of Highly Pathogenic Avian Influenza, African Swine Wever and Bovine Viral Diarrhoea. Scientific discussions followed the signing of the agreement.

By sharing expertise and resources, FLI and PIWet aim to improve diagnostic capabilities and find faster solutions to current and future animal health challenges. Through their formal agreement, the two renowned research institutions will strengthen the exchange of experience and information flow in order to make the best use of their available resources. FLI President Prof Dr Christa Kühn said at the signing: "This groundbreaking partnership between FLI and PIWet is a significant step towards strengthening cooperation in the field of animal health and animal disease research between Germany and Poland".
